Margaret Fitzgerald
Known as a risk-taker in the world of 21st-century art, Margaret Fitzgerald creates textured and provocative abstract paintings that are rife with audacious colors, forms and scratches she makes in the surface of the canvases.
Born in London, England, Fitzgerald grew up in Japan and the United States, where she lived in Connecticut with her family before moving to New Mexico at the age of 18. Fitzgerald developed an interest in art in her youth and studied fine art and art history at the School of Visual Arts and the Art Students League in New York. She also attended the Instituto Allende in San Miguel Allende, Mexico, and earned a bachelor’s degree in fine art from the University of New Mexico.
Since becoming a full-time creative more than 20 years ago, the inspiration for Fitzgerald’s sizeable abstract oil paintings and mixed media works have evolved from an introspective examination of her life to reactions to the political climate and societal issues.
Fitzgerald has exhibited her paintings in solo and group shows in New York City, San Francisco, New Mexico and elsewhere throughout the United States and Europe. Her works are held in several private collections in the U.S. and around the world, including Tokyo, Japan and the Venetian Hotels in Las Vegas, Macao, China and Stockholm, Sweden.

Provenance Compass Rose, Chicago Born Sylvan Irwin Goldberg in 1924 and raised in the Bronx, Michael Goldberg was an important figure in American Abstract Expressionism, who began taking art classes at the Art Students League in 1938. A gifted student, Goldberg finished high school at the age of 14 and enrolled in City College. He soon found New York’s jazz scene to be a more compelling environment, and he began skipping classes in favor of the Harlem jazz clubs near campus. Goldberg’s love of jazz would become a lifelong passion and a key component to his approach to composition in his paintings. From 1940 to 1942, like many of the leading artists of the New York School, Goldberg studied with Hans Hofmann. In 1943, he put his pursuit of painting on hold and enlisted in the U.S. Army. Serving in North Africa, Burma, and India, Goldberg received a Purple Heart and a Bronze Star before being discharged in 1946. After his service, he traveled and worked in Venezuela before returning to the United States, settling back in New York and resuming studies with Hofmann and at the Art Students League. Living downtown and frequenting the Cedar Bar, Goldberg befriended many of the artists of the New York School. In 1951, his work was included in the groundbreaking Ninth Street Show, co-organized by Leo Castelli, Conrad Marca-Relli, and the Eighth Street Club, and featuring the work of - among others - Hofmann, Jackson Pollock, Willem de Kooning, and Franz Kline.
